Chevron is a 6 year old bay gelding. Chevron is trained by C W Gibbs, at Ruakaka and owned by Markwood Lodge Ltd.
Chevron’s last race event was at 25/11/2023 and their next race is on 25/11/2023 at Pukekohe Park.
Career form is 5 wins, 4 seconds, 6 thirds from 24 starts with a lifetime career prize money of $156,656.
With a 21% Win Percentage and 63% Place Percentage. Chevron's last race event was at Pukekohe Park.
Exposed form for its last starts is 9-0-1-2-4.
